Direct answer: Municipal water meters register volume, not composition — air and turbulence moving through the meter get counted as billable water even though nothing was actually delivered. In a food plant, line startups, CIP runs, and nightly sanitation draw create exactly the conditions that cause this over-registration, every operating day. Because sewer charges are typically calculated from metered water intake, the same over-read inflates both bills at once. CIP Systems Are the Biggest Meter Over-Reading Driver in Most Food Plants
Clean-in-place systems typically account for the largest share of water consumption in a food or beverage processing facility — and they’re also the most significant source of meter over-reading. CIP cycles involve repeated high-volume on-off flow events, rapid pressure changes, and variable flow rates — exactly the conditions that introduce the highest levels of entrained air, micro-bubbles, and turbulent vortex flow into the water line.
Every CIP cycle, your meter over-reads the actual water volume delivered. That over-reading compounds across every cycle, every day.
